Summary

Overview

In 2024, Kolhapur averaged an AQI of 100 while Malegaon averaged 114 — a 14-point (14%) gap, with Malegaon the more polluted and Kolhapur the cleaner of the two. On 354 days when both cities reported, Kolhapur was cleaner on 196 of them; the average daily gap was 34 AQI points.

Seasonality & days

Both cities see their worst air in November on average. Kolhapur logged 0% Severe days and 46.400000000000006% Good-or-Satisfactory days; Malegaon was 0% Severe and 48% Good-or-Satisfactory. Longest clean-air streaks: Kolhapur 81 days, Malegaon 51 days.

Year-over-year progress

The worst recorded day for Kolhapur reached AQI 321 at Shivaji University (MPCB) on 2024-11-12; Malegaon hit AQI 298 at Mahesh Nagar (MPCB) on 2024-07-07.

Station-level disparity

Kolhapur spans 2 CPCB stations with a 19-point spread (min 90, max 109); Malegaon spans 1 stations with a 0-point spread (min 109, max 109).
